Originally Posted by jonnymerk
Does the exhaust brackets and such not provided enough bracing?
Our turbos are larger than normal units and are pretty heavy. And the manifold is pretty heavy also. Extra bracing just ensures that you don't crack something.

Ok, just got back from picking up the block and stuff. Heres a few pics of the stuff. I didnt take a pic of the crank but everything is balanced to within a tenth a gram and good to 10,000 rpms. He had to make the rod big end and small end a little larger because the clearances were way to tight. He also deglazed the cylinder walls for me
